I should start this off by saying I'm fairly new-ish to the game, so a lot of mechanics/ways of doing things are quite new to me still

 

One thing that seems to have stood out while doing buildings/moving items in crates is that there's not really a clean way to just move a crate up a floor, for example instead of building a 2nd Floor by bringing a crate up, I've had to drag items up and carry them along, with a low Body Strength this can result in a lot of time spent simply dragging objects around, but for now, its do-able.

 

This suggestion really is to suggest some sort of lift/elevator system, be it mechanical with chains or simply be a rope-based pulley system that the player can utilise to move larger containers up/down floors without the need to bulk move items instead, this could possibly extend out to all items/entities also, but for now even items would be great

allready in place.

 

you can pull crates up with a rope, need a ladder to do it, stairs wont work.

No, thank you.

 

You can hall up.  I understand, though, that this isn't possible with body strength under 23.

If you are careful you can open containers on the ground floor from the next floor up.  I have done this a lot - fiddled a bit until I got an empty container upstairs and transfer everything into it.

I believe a wagon can be accessed from both ground floor and 1st floor up.

Here's how it could work.

Your building would have double doors on every floor.

The top floor would have a modified "Double Door Goods Hoist" that would include

  • a wooden beam
  • tackle
  • heavy rope

You could then stand on any floor, (look up at the hoist?) and use the Hoist action to haul a crate or other object to your current floor.

It wouldn't be very different from the current ladder system, but it would look very nice
